**Core Concept**
The objective lens used in microlaryngoscopy is designed to provide a clear and magnified view of the laryngeal structures. The focal length of the objective lens is critical in determining the working distance and the field of view.
**Why the Correct Answer is Right**
The correct focal length of the objective lens used in microlaryngoscopy is typically 300-400 mm. This allows for a good balance between magnification and working distance, enabling the surgeon to maneuver the endoscope and instruments with ease. The 300-400 mm focal length also provides a reasonable field of view, allowing the surgeon to visualize the entire larynx without having to compromise on magnification.
